Details
The "Sagar Samman Award- Sagar Samman Varuna Award" scheme has been launched by the Ministry of Ports,Shipping and Waterways under the Directorate General of Shipping, Government of India aims to recognize exceptionally outstanding and lifelong contributions in the Indian maritime sector. Under this scheme, the highest level of national recognition in the maritime domain is provided to distinguished individuals or entities demonstrating leadership and excellence.

Eligibility
- The applicant should be an Indian citizen, Person of Indian Origin (PIO), or Overseas Citizen of India (OCI).
- The applicant should have at least 5 years of outstanding contributions.
- The applicant should have contributed significantly in at least 2 major maritime areas.
- The applicant should demonstrate leadership, innovation, and institutional impact.
- The applicant should have impeccable integrity and reputation.
- The applicant should be nominated by at least 2 entities or peers; self-nomination requires 2 recommendations.
- The applicant should not have any reputational or ethical issues.
- Government serving officers are not eligible.

Application Process
Online
Step 01: Visit the National Awards Portal: https://www.awards.gov.in
Step 02: Register/Login using the official credentials of the recommending authority
Step 03: Fill in the nomination form with complete details
Step 04: Upload required documents, including citation and verification certificate
